- [ ] **Step 7: Breaker override escrow.** After sealing the signing keys for the Tallgrove upstream API circuit breaker, confirm the support team can force the breaker open during a full outage. The override bundle lives in the sealed escrow drawer and is useless without its unlock phrase. Two ceremony witnesses must initial this step before proceeding. The escrow bundle is decrypted with the recovery passphrase that follows.

vault phrase of kahip-kahop = holath-quenmir

## Ticket: Intermittent connection failures — Paritywatch rate checker

The rate-parity crawler drops its DB connection roughly every 40 minutes. Pool recycling was set shorter than the server's idle timeout; workers grab dead connections and fail mid-scan. Fix: bump pool recycle to 300s and enable pre-ping. New folks reproducing this locally should point the checker at the staging database using the connection below.

replica DSN, yahog-kawig: redis://istox_svc:um@db-8a67.halixforge.test:5432/frawyn

Plugin authors: the Quillbox billing worker uses blue-green deploys, so two environments run during every rollout. Your plugin must tolerate both versions processing the queue simultaneously for up to ten minutes; make handlers idempotent and avoid schema assumptions during the overlap window. Traffic flips only after the green pool drains its warm-up checks. If you need to inspect a stalled flip, the deploy console's read-only mode unlocks with the recovery passphrase given directly below.

recovery phrase for bawep-kawef: oliath-casdor

## Who to ping about GiftNote

Welcome aboard! GiftNote is our donation-receipt mailer for the Larchfield Fund. Template tweaks go to the comms folks; delivery failures and bounce weirdness go to the platform crew. Don't push template changes on Fridays — receipts batch over the weekend. For anything GiftNote-related, start with the address below.

billing contact of kaweg-tajeg = drudor.lamion.oliath@torvalabs.test